Former Secular States

  • Iran - Became a secular state in 1925 after Reza Pahlavi was installed as Shah. Islam was re-instituted as the state religion in December 1979 following the adoption of a new constitution.
  • Madagascar (1960–2007) Constitution with "laïc" removed
  • Iraq (1932–1968) - Became a secular state in 1932 after Iraqi independence. Islam was instituted as the state religion in 1968 following the adoption of a new constitution.
